An UberEats driver in Bondi has been caught going to a public toilet and taking their delivery bag inside the cubicle. 

 

The photo, posted on the Bondi Local Loop Facebook page, shows the man's feet from underneath the cubicle wall and his pants sitting down around his ankles.

The UberEats bag can be seen on the floor between his feet. However, it is unknown if there was food inside when the photo was taken.

Still, people had a lot of thoughts about the whole thing.
